For more than 200 years, the U.S. Army Medical Department (AMEDD) has served and protected U.S. forces and their Families, worked to save the lives of civilians and improved health care systems in areas of operations.
 
The Army Health Care Team, is one of the biggest health care networks in the world and offers its members the opportunity to practice their specialty in world-renowned hospitals, clinics and health care facilities
 
In addition, the U.S. Army offers one of the most comprehensive scholarships available in health care. For those seeking a career as a physician, dentist, veterinarian, optometrist, clinical, counseling psychologist or psychiatric nurse practitioner, the F. Edward Hebert Armed Forces Health Professions Scholarship Program (HPSP) offers a unique opportunity for financial support of their education. The Structure
AMEDD offers a number of health care career opportunities to both practicing health care professionals as well as to those in the beginning stages of their professions. AMEDD is comprised of six Corps:

  • Dental Corps
  • Medical Corps
  • Medical Service Corps
  • Medical Specialist Corps
  • Nurse Corps
  • Veterinary Corps

 
A career as an Army health care professional offers experience such as direct patient care, research, disease prevention, allied health care fields or veterinary medicine.
